Player Overview
Jinbao Li, often referred to as "Jinbao," is a Chinese-American professional poker player who has built his career in the U.S. poker scene. Known for a solid technical foundation and a calm table presence, he is active in live poker events, particularly high-stakes cash games and major tournaments in the United States.
